1. Keyword Research for Melbourne Electricians
The foundation of any SEO strategy is keyword research. You need to find the terms your potential customers are using. Start with broad terms like “electrician Melbourne” or “Melbourne electrician.” Then, add more specific phrases such as “emergency electrician Melbourne,” “residential electrician Melbourne,” or “commercial electrician Melbourne.” Use tools like Google Keyword Planner, Ahrefs, or SEMrush to find keywords with good search volume and low competition. Don’t forget long-tail keywords like “affordable electrician in Melbourne’s eastern suburbs” or “24-hour electrician near Fitzroy.” These often convert better because they indicate a specific need.
2. On-Page SEO for Your Electrician Website
Once you have your keywords, incorporate them naturally into your website’s content. Key places to include them:
- Title tags: Each page should have a unique title tag that includes your primary keyword. For example, “Reliable Electrician Melbourne | Your Company Name.”
- Meta descriptions: Write compelling meta descriptions that include your keyword and a call to action. Keep them under 160 characters.
- Headings (H1, H2, H3): Use headings to structure your content and include keywords where relevant.
- Body content: Write informative, helpful content that answers common questions. Use keywords naturally, but don’t overdo it.
- URLs: Make your URLs short and descriptive, e.g., yourwebsite.com/melbourne-electrician.
- Images: Use alt text with keywords for all images.
3. Google Business Profile Optimization
Your Google Business Profile (GBP) is critical for local SEO. Claim and verify your profile, then fill out every section completely. Ensure your business name, address, and phone number (NAP) are consistent with what’s on your website. Add high-quality photos of your work, your team, and your vehicle. Choose the right categories (e.g., “Electrician”). Write a detailed business description that includes your keywords. Encourage customers to leave reviews, and respond to every review, positive or negative. Post updates regularly, such as special offers or safety tips.
4. Local Citations and Directory Listings
Citations are mentions of your NAP on other websites. They help Google verify your business’s location and legitimacy. Start with the major directories: Google Business Profile, Bing Places, Yelp, Yellow Pages, True Local, and Hotfrog. Then, look for local Melbourne directories, such as local chamber of commerce sites or community portals. Ensure your NAP is identical across all listings. Inconsistent information can hurt your rankings. Use tools like Moz Local or BrightLocal to manage citations.
5. Online Reviews and Reputation Management
Reviews are a powerful ranking factor and influence potential customers. Ask every satisfied client to leave a review on Google. Make it easy by sending them a direct link. Respond to all reviews professionally. Address negative feedback calmly and offer to resolve the issue. A steady stream of positive reviews signals trustworthiness to Google and to users.
6. Content Marketing for Electricians
Creating helpful content can boost your SEO and establish you as an expert. Write blog posts about common electrical problems, safety tips, or how-to guides. For example: “5 Signs You Need to Rewire Your Melbourne Home” or “How to Choose the Right Electrician in Melbourne.” Include local references, like mentioning suburbs or landmarks. This content can rank for informational queries and attract visitors who may later hire you.
7. Link Building
Backlinks from reputable websites signal authority to Google. Reach out to local businesses, suppliers, or industry associations for partnerships. You could write guest posts for home improvement blogs or get featured in local news. Sponsor local events or charities and ask for a link. High-quality links from Melbourne-based sites are especially valuable.
8. Technical SEO for Local Search
Ensure your website is technically sound. It should be mobile-friendly, since many people search on phones. Improve page speed by compressing images and using caching. Use schema markup (LocalBusiness schema) to help Google understand your business details. Fix any broken links or crawl errors. A fast, secure, and easy-to-navigate site ranks better.
Measuring Your SEO Success
Track your progress using tools like Google Analytics and Google Search Console. Monitor your rankings for target keywords, organic traffic, and conversions (e.g., phone calls or contact form submissions). Check your Google Business Profile insights to see how many people find you via search or maps. Adjust your strategy based on what’s working.
Common SEO Mistakes Melbourne Electricians Make
- Ignoring local keywords: Using only broad terms like “electrician” without location.
- Inconsistent NAP: Different phone numbers or addresses across the web.
- Neglecting reviews: Not asking for reviews or not responding to them.
- Poor mobile experience: A site that’s hard to use on phones.
- Duplicate content: Using the same text on multiple pages.
